Yes, it... WebAug 31, 2024 · A majority of Christians (57%) say sex between unmarried adults in a committed relationship is sometimes or always acceptable. Contact your Parish. If you believe you meet the requirements above (or if you need to discuss them), you should contact your parish to discuss your wedding. You’ll need to obtain permission to be married in the Church, whether it is at your current parish or elsewhere. Check with the diocese or the parish where the wedding will take place ... WebWell, if two Catholics, previously married to others and subsequently divorced, sought to marry in the Church, virtually any priest would have told them “No way, not without an annulment” (canon 1085 again). Unfortunately, such Catholics not infrequently then turn to civil magistrates for their wedding.
